ELET 283 - Electronics Communications

3 lecture hours, 3 lab hours, 4 credit hours
Overview of electronics communications theory and laboratory experience including transmitting and receiving techniques using amplitude, frequency and phase modulation.  In this course, the students will be provided a complete set of discrete components to build a Super-Heterodyne AM receiver.  Prerequisite(s): ELET 155. Course/Lab Fee $65
